Entrepreneurship is fascinating—because it requires you to believe in you more than anyone else does. That belief becomes the fuel: to dream, to start, and to keep going.

It’s an endless scroll of ideas, half-finished notes, drafted launch plans, and sparks of “maybe one day.” It’s freedom that sometimes feels like a trap.

You are responsible for everything—good, bad, or indifferent. Accountability begins and ends with you, and how you handle it determines how far you’ll go.

Entrepreneurship is wanting things to be perfect, while knowing perfection doesn’t exist. Progress is the product of personal evolution.

It’s feeling both inspired by others and overwhelmed by the pressure to turn every suggestion into a deliverable. It’s flexibility, rooted in consistency. It’s being the boss while still craving direction, mentorship, and reassurance.

It’s a chokehold—a beautiful, brutal one—that your vision keeps you in.

Entrepreneurship is knowing you didn’t come this far to only come this far.

No matter how many years you’ve put in, you’re always at the beginning of something. Again.


Entrepreneurship is hard, but you can do hard things.
